Structure
Rockstar Games is a video game development company and company created in 1998 to create ‘the most innovative and progressive interactive entertainment’ and is owned by Take-Two interactive. Based in New York City, Rockstar Games is commonly known for its AAA title Grand Theft Auto series. Rockstar Games are also commonly known to providing open world games with free play ability (no solid story line). The company comprises of several other acquired or renamed companies which have merged to create the Rockstar Brand.
Although Rockstar itself was created in New York City, the company was actually founded by English games designers Sam Houser and Dan Houser; both of whom are co-founders of the company. Rockstar games has also bought English games company BMG Interactive shortly after passing ownership to Take-Two interactive.

Game Types
Rockstar games develop across multiple different genres and game types, although most commonly they are well known across the world for their work on the Action, Drama and Freeplay genres with their award winning Grand Theft Auto (GTA) series following exactly that. Due to their popular success in their mature game development, it might come to some surprise that RockStar also have made games such as: ‘Rockstar games presents: Table Tennis’, a game developed for the Nintendo Wii console aimed at a younger audience and placed within the sports genre. The company have also developed games in the Racing, western and stealth genres as well.

Regulatory Bodies
Rockstar Games uses PEGI (Pan European Game Information) for it’s information board. PEGI is a games rating Information Company that states the legal age to purchase the game and could either be: 3, 7, 12, 16, or 18. Most of rockstar’s games fall under the 18 category however some of their games for (e.g) the Nintendo wii, fall under the ‘3’ category as they are aimed at younger children.
Development Software

Rockstar Games uses the RAGE (rockstar advanced game engine) which is developed by the RAGE Technology Group and was used to produce award winning games GTA V, Red dead redemption and Max Payne 3.  RAGE technology group is a company owned by rockstar san Diego and is not commercially available for other companies to use.
